The Sanskrit term “Graha” is frequently confused with the English word “planet.” This is a fairly crude translation that obscures the word’s true meaning. The term “graha” alludes to a being with the ability to “seize, lay hold of, or grip.” As a result, Graha means to comprehend or take hold of the meaning that the planets possess. This connotation is linked to the nakshatras (also known as moon mansions, or a 27-fold split of the zodiac), which are defined in similar terms.

Graha thus extends beyond the concept of a planet to include the power of celestial events to impact or forecast happenings on Earth. Because this relationship has no known physical basis, astrology is not accepted by the scientific community. We prefer the name Graha to planet because it communicates a more profound connotation. Furthermore, using the phrase planet isn’t technically correct. Surya / Ravi (the Sun), Chandra / Sandu (the Moon), Mangal / Kuja (Mars), Budha (Mercury), Guru / Brahpathi (Jupiter), Shukra / Sikuru (Venus), Shani / Senasuru (Saturn), Rahu (Northern lunar node), and Ketu (Southern lunar node) are the nine Grahas (Planets) (Southern lunar node). The Sun is a star rather than a planet. Rahu and Ketu are not planets, and they aren’t even physical beings.

According to their general auspicious and inauspicious tendencies, the Grahas are classified into two groups. Saumya, or benefic, and Krura, or malefic, are the Sanskrit words for these two groups. Beneficial planets include the Waxing Moon, Mercury, Jupiter, and Venus. Malefic planets include the Sun, Saturn, Mars, Waning Moon, Rahu, and Ketu.

Conjunction occurs when two planets of the same sign align. Planets that are in the same sign as each other are said to aspect each other. Mars, Jupiter, and Saturn all have unique aspects. The sign in which a planet is found is extremely significant. The planet’s attributes are shown more forcefully and auspiciously when the sign is favorable to it. The person in question will get more rewards in various aspects of life that the planets represent. If the sign is particularly unfavorable, on the other hand, the planet will become inauspicious and may cause issues and strife in whatever aspect of life it symbolizes.

In astrology, the personal planets (which include the sun, moon, Mercury, Venus, and Mars) reveal a lot about our personalities and how we react to situations. However, Jupiter in astrology informs us more about how we react to wider themes inside ourselves and society as a whole because it is one of the transpersonal social planets (which are further away from the sun than the personal planets and have a more collective impact). Jupiter rules subjects like philosophy, spiritual beliefs, morals, and higher education, thus this planet urges us to think big and explore the far reaches of the human soul. Jupiter is the traditional ruler of Pisces and the ruling planet of Sagittarius in the zodiac, thus its energy is very essential to anyone born with a lot of Sag or Pisces energy in their astrological birth chart.

Moon is the planet responsible for the mind and its actions, according to Vedic astrology. There will be mental anguish if there are any afflictions to the moon. Certain planetary alignments are known to make people depressed.

When Saturn forms a conjunction with or aspects the Moon, it has a negative effect on emotions. Saturn is a planet associated with our karmic records, which is why it serves as a wake-up call in this pairing.

When Rahu conjuncts the Moon, the person begins to daydream and hallucinate, resulting in impulsive behavior. Aggression leads to a slew of fights and, in the end, isolation, which leads to despair.

When Ketu links to the Moon, it disconnects you from the rest of the world. Isolation leads to depression as a result of detachment.

Obstacles and disputes arise while the Moon is in the 6th house. Sudden occurrences and shocks are associated with the Moon in the 8th house. Isolation and solitude are associated with the Moon in the 12th house. As a result, a sick moon can be exceedingly inauspicious, leaving a person feeling helpless and despondent.

When the Moon is trapped between malefic planets like Mars, Saturn, Rahu, or Ketu, it can cause depression. Houses and degrees are also important factors. Mars causes rage, Saturn causes negative ideas, and Rahu and Ketu cause rash behavior. Depression results from this imbalance.
